Common Mistakes to Avoid
- Over-layering with heavy knits: Thick sweaters under heavy jackets restrict movement. Stick to one heavy piece and keep others lightweight.
- Ignoring fabric breathability: Cotton holds sweat. On active days, choose a moisture-wicking base like a tri-blend tee.
- Mixing conflicting colors: Silo merch uses muted earth tones. Bright neon accessories clash. Stick to blacks, greens, and browns.
- Skipping the test walk: Always walk around in your layers for five minutes. If you sweat or can't bend, remove a layer.
